I try to connect to the following server as a homework excercise from school.

cookie.update.uu.se 8445

But once it's connected, I see a blank screen and it appears as if it's frozen. But when I hit the enter key, a fortune cookie message is display and connection is terminated?

According to the instruction on my lab book, the server is supposed to ask me a couple question and display a fortune cookie message. I try to set the echo by typing "set LOCAL_ECHO" but telnet doesn't recognize the command. Any idea what's wrong? Thanks

'local echo' only echoes your own keystrokes back to the screen. It has nothing to do with data sent to you from the host.

The server you are connecting to there is not a telnet server. It's some kind of fortune cookie server, but it's definitely not asking any questions. Just serving up fortunes.
